Happy 50th Oma and Opa!!



My sweet Oma and Opa celebrated their 50th wedding anniversary. What a great experience to be here for! The whole family was able to get together for it. We had a family dinner at the Grand America. It was so fun. We had the "Anniversary Game" played throughout the night where each of the 6 son's got up and asked different questions about their life from when they met to where we are now with our family in life. It was so fun, some of the questions were down right hilarious and some of you know, when you're at a gathering with Vielstich's (especially ALL of the brothers) it is nothing but laughter! We had lots of singing and a great slide show that was put together that had pictures from when they were babies up until just a couple months ago. We also got a family portriat done which turned out great! Thanks again David... you did great, as usual!

Oma and Opa have raised 6 boys and now have 23 grand kids (including one that's up in Heaven) and 1 and a half great grand babies. And 3 grand son in laws.

This is a pretty cool break down that they are pretty proud of... All 6 boys are eagle scouts, all 6 boys served missions, all 6 boys graduated college, all 6 boys married in the temple and all 6 boys raising families of their own.

Both Oma and Opa came over from Germany when they were in their teens. They have the most amazing and scary stories from sneaking out of Germany with nothing and stories from the war's. They are still so happily in love. They are a great example to Preston and I on a loving, long, honest relationship. And man, do they have the craziest stories of when my dad and uncles were little... what do you expect? 6 boys?! Wow..

So Friday night was great and Saturday they had an open house for more friends and family who weren't at the dinner. It was so fun to see a lot of their friends that we hear about all the time. And as we were casually eating food and hanging out.. who walks in? President Uchtdorf and his wife. Oma knew President Uchtdorf when they were little in Germany. They were even in the same primary class. And they've kept in touch throught the years. It was such a cool experience to meet him. His accent is even cooler in real life haha. He was so down to earth and him and his wife hung out with everybody for about an hour. What a cool treat to have somebody like him show up at your house for your anniversary! He was so happy and so willing to meet everybody. His wife is such a classy and sweet lady!
